Miller v. Riley et al (INMATE 1) (CONSENT), No. 2:2010cv00818 - Document 38 (M.D. Ala. 2013)

Court Description: FINAL JUDGMENT: In accordance with the memorandum opinion entered herewith, it is the ORDER, JUDGMENT and DECREE of this court that: 1. The defendants motion for summary judgment be GRANTED; 2. Judgment be GRANTED in favor of the defendants; 3. This case be DISMISSED with prejudice; and 4. The costs of this proceeding be taxed against the plaintiff. Signed by Honorable Judge Wallace Capel, Jr on 5/30/2013. (Attachments: # 1 Civil Appeals Checklist)(jg, )
